There’s proverb that goes “Russia is the motherland of elephants”, it pokes fun at a special brand of patriots who claim Russia to be the cradle of earth’s humanity and the origin of everything.
Before you decide it’s fringe group of lunatics, an MP from the ruling party not long ago used the floor to declare war on the USA for killing “American Indians who are in fact Russian emigrants who went their across the Bering land bridge” 🫤
Speaker of the Ekaterinburg local “parliament” announced that he’s obtained extrasensoric capabilities and can now heal people by looking at them or touching them with his hands.
Should Ukraine start winning this war we’ll see more examples of top Russian officials pleading insanity
